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Leeds to Harlech is to drive which costs £35 - £55 and takes 2h 52m.
The fastest way to get from Leeds to Harlech is to drive which takes 2h 52m and costs £35 - £55.
No, there is no direct train from Leeds to Harlech. However, there are services departing from Leeds and arriving at Harlech via Manchester Piccadilly, Shrewsbury and Machynlleth.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 7h 38m.
The distance between Leeds and Harlech is 185 miles. The road distance is 142.5 miles.
